The Russian Ministry of Defense announced the liberation of 9 Russian soldiers from captivity in Ukraine.
The ministry said in a statement today: “As a result of the negotiation process, 9 Russian soldiers were returned today from the lands controlled by the Kyiv regime,” noting that they were at risk of dying in captivity.
The statement continued: The liberated soldiers will be transported to Moscow on a military transport plane, noting that the necessary medical and psychological assistance has been provided to them.
